Design Considerations for a 10x10 L Shaped Kitchen Layout
When designing a 10x10 L shaped kitchen layout, there are several factors to consider to ensure that the space works for you:
Work Triangle: Position the sink, stove, and refrigerator in a triangular formation to create an efficient workflow and reduce fatigue.

Cabinets and Storage: Choose a mix of tall and short cabinets to create a visually appealing and functional layout. Don't forget to include pull-out drawers and shelves for easy access to your cookware and dishes.
Counter Space and Island: Consider adding a kitchen island or peninsula to provide additional counter space and seating for food preparation and socializing.
Lighting and Ventilation: Ensure adequate lighting and ventilation in the kitchen to create a comfortable and safe cooking environment.
